Paint will stick to wood surfaces, even those that already have a coat of stain or glossy varnish. The surface has to be roughed up for proper adhesion, so taking the steps necessary to adequately prepare the finish for paint produces the best results. Roughed, scratched surfaces allow the p...
The key to painting laminate cabinets or factory finish wood cabinets is to prime with the right primer. The surface of these cabinets is extremely shiny and smooth and, without proper prep work, the finish will scratch right off. Another important factor is going to be choosing a high-qualit...
